Factors Affecting Cost

Disability shower installations in Philadelphia, PA, are designed to improve accessibility and safety. These projects typically involve modifications to existing bathrooms to accommodate mobility needs, ensuring compliance with local building codes and accessibility standards. Understanding the scope and typical considerations can help in planning and budgeting for such installations.

  • Materials: Options include low-threshold or curbless showers, grab bars, and slip-resistant flooring, using durable materials suited for bathroom environments.
  • Size and Scope: Shower dimensions vary based on space availability, with common sizes ranging from 36x36 inches to larger accessible designs, often requiring modifications to existing bathroom layouts.
  • Labor Complexity: Installation may involve plumbing adjustments, wall modifications, and ensuring proper waterproofing, which can influence the overall complexity.
  • Permitting: Local permits are typically required in Philadelphia, PA, for structural changes, plumbing work, and accessibility modifications, with approval processes varying by project scope.
  • Extras: Additional features such as seating, handheld shower heads, and waterproof wall panels can be included to enhance functionality and comfort.

Project Size and Complexity

Scope/Size Typical Range
Standard Walk-In Shower (36” x 36”) $2,500 - $5,000
Accessible Shower with Handrails $4,000 - $8,000
Roll-In Shower (custom size) $6,000 - $12,000
Shower Seat Installation $500 - $1,500
Complete Accessibility Remodel $10,000 - $20,000+

In Philadelphia, PA, project costs for disability shower installations can vary based on specific site conditions and selected features.
